Project Overview

After onboarding, your first assignment will be to start a fundraising campaign. Haiti Now will provide further guidance for you to have a quick and successful fundraiser.


Role brief: Facebook Expert is a virtual volunteer position that works directly with the Marketing Project Manager.

Note: Please provide writing samples for evaluationResponsibilities:
Create content for 2-3 Facebook posts per week, which include writing engaging copy and selecting an image from an image bank to edit
Suggest opportunities for growing community and engagement
Attend a weekly meeting with the marketing team to provide updates

Qualifications/Requirements:
Bachelor’s required, Marketing background preferred
Minimum volunteer hours expected: 7 hrs per week
Demonstrated ability to write successful Facebook content (Samples needed)
Detail-oriented, organized, deadline-driven
Clear, precise and compelling writing skills
Motivated self starter with the ability to work independently in a fast-paced environment
Proficient with Facebook guidelines and regulations
Proficiency with Google Suite Apps such as Drive, Sheets, etc.
Familiarity with or quick adoption of Trello and Slack tools important
Our Vision
To see girls in domestic servitude overcome extreme poverty, heal emotional trauma, and live rewarding lives.

Our Mission

Haiti-Now is dedicated to empowering Haitian girls living in domestic servitude to overcome poverty and exploitation to achieve economic security.

We are fully committed to housing, healing, and educating Haiti’s most vulnerable girls. We believe an economically secure future is possible. Our goal is that every girl in our accelerated education program will attain a sixth-grade diploma in just three years. By helping her graduate sixth grade, you can change her future.
